Factors Affecting Cost
- Materials: The type and quality of materials used for the drain, such as PVC, metal, or concrete, can significantly influence the overall cost.
- Labor: The complexity of the installation and the expertise required can affect labor costs. Skilled professionals may charge more for their services.
- Drainage System Design: Custom designs or more complex drainage systems can increase costs due to the additional planning and materials needed.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the installation site, including any necessary excavation or grading, can impact the cost.
- Additional Features: Extras like decorative grates, advanced filtration systems, or integrated irrigation can add to the overall price.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ost Range |
---|---|
Basic PVC Drain Installation | $1,500 - $2,500 |
Metal Drain Installation | $2,500 - $4,000 |
Custom Drainage System | $3,000 - $6,000 |
Site Preparation and Grading | $500 - $1,500 |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$300 |
Additional Features | $300 - $1,000 |
